Bring in Black
Obviously, replacing the window itself is a great option, and if you’re able to do that, think about using a black versus a white frame. You’ll see that the result is a contemporary look that will be in style for years to come. Plus, it will add a sleek, clean aesthetic to the space. You’ll also note that the black will contrast nicely with other materials in the room, like wood or brick.
Choose Minimalism
Minimalist style continues to trend, so why not bring the look to your window? For a new build, think about going with large windows for a ton of natural light to make the room (and your home) look more spacious. Good minimalist window treatments for these windows include something with clean lines and fabrics in neutral colors like gray or cream. Bring in Texture
Textures are trending, and many of them will prove to be timeless. Made from grasses, reeds, woods, and bamboo, Provenance® Woven Wood Shades can help bring the outdoors in. Other textural choices include suede and leather, which can both add pizzazz at the window. Additional trending options include hemp, velvet, and linen.
